FabledCurator Firefox Extension
Self-hosted Firefox extension that pushes session cookies from supported platforms (Patreon, SubscribeStar, Hentai-Foundry, Discord, Pixiv) into FabledCurator, and lets you add a creator as a Source from their page in one click.
Install (operator)
The signed XPI is bundled into the FC Docker image — :dev and
:latest each carry their own channel's build. Open FC →
Settings → Maintenance → Browser extension → click "Install Firefox
extension". Firefox shows its native install prompt. After installing,
open the extension's options page (about:addons → FabledCurator →
Preferences) and paste in the FC URL + extension API key shown on the
same card.

Versioning — don't hand-edit the patch number
The shipped version is derived, not committed. scripts/packaging.sh version returns MAJOR.MINOR from manifest.json plus a patch component
that is the commit time of the newest change to a packaged extension file,
in minutes since 2020-01-01. build.yml computes it and stamps it into both
manifest.json and package.json at build time. The stamp is never
committed — the commit carrying it would itself be a change to the extension,
which would move the version again.
So:
- Editing the patch number does nothing. It is overwritten before web-ext ever reads it. There is no bump to make, and none to forget.
- MAJOR.MINOR is still yours. It carries the deliberate meaning, it is read
from
manifest.jsonalone, and CI fails theextension-versionlane if the two files disagree on it. npm run buildlocally produces an XPI labelled with the committed version, since nothing stamped it. Fine for loading into a test profile; not what ships.
Why commit time and not a commit count: a count is per-branch, so dev and
main count different histories of the same code and their versions end up
ordered by which branch accumulated more commits rather than by which is newer.
Commit time gives both branches the same number for the same source — which is
exactly what lets one AMO signature serve both channels (family rule 149, FC
issue #3092).
Channels
dev and main each build and sign their own extension, and an install is
tied to whichever FC instance it points at — Firefox's static update_url
cannot apply here, since every FC install is a different host, so the extension
asks its configured backend. The channel therefore IS the instance.
Switching channel means repointing the FC URL in options and reinstalling from
that host; there is no separate channel setting, and adding one would
contradict each server build shipping its own extension.
The channel is reported beside the version, never inside it:
/api/extension/manifest answers {"version": "...", "channel": "dev"}. It is
optional — an instance that declares none simply omits the key, and the popup,
the toolbar tooltip and the Settings card all read exactly as they did before
the field existed. Do not be tempted to make it a -dev version suffix: the
comparator parses each dotted segment with parseInt, so a suffixed segment
reads as 0 and every dev build compares equal to every other, collapsing "no
update available" and "I cannot read this version" into one answer.
Release
Nothing to do by hand. Push to dev: build.yml signs the extension if this
change moved the version, caches the signed XPI as a Forgejo ext-<version>
release, and bundles it into fabledcurator:dev. Merging to main derives the
same version, hits that cache, and bundles the byte-identical XPI into
:latest with no second AMO call.
AMO refuses to re-sign a version it has already issued, so signing is one-shot per version — which is why the cache exists and why the version must never move backwards.
